What companies run services between Gili Islands, Indonesia and Tokyo, Japan?

There is no direct connection from Gili Islands to Tokyo. However, you can take the ferry to Serangan, take the taxi to McDonald's Sanur, take the bus to Ngurah Rai Airport, walk to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PS) airport, fly to Narita International Airport (NRT), walk to 空港第2ビル Narita Airport Terminal 2·3, then take the train to Tōkyō Station. Alternatively, you can take the ferry to Serangan, take the taxi to McDonald's Sanur, take the bus to Ngurah Rai Airport, walk to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PS) airport, fly to Tokyo International Airport (HND), walk to 羽田空港第1ターミナル Haneda Airport Terminal 1, take the train to モノレール浜松町 Monorail Hamamatsuchō, then take the train to Tōkyō Station.
